The Granfondo Routes: Challenge and scenery
Participants will have the choice of three routes to suit different abilities and preferences:
The Long Route (up to 120 km) is the most challenging and is best suited to experienced cyclists. With demanding climbs and breathtaking elevation gains, it is a real test for cycling enthusiasts.
The Medium Route (approx. 85 km) offers a moderate yet no less fascinating challenge, passing through the medieval village of Mondaino and San Bartolo Park.
Squalo 46, a short 46 km route designed for beginners and tourists who want to enjoy the beauty of the area without the pressure of the stopwatch. A relaxing yet exciting route that celebrates the connection with Valentino Rossi and his hometown, Tavullia.

A growing event: Granfondo Squali 2025
With 3,200 participants in the 2025 edition, the Granfondo Squali has established itself as one of Italy’s most important amateur cycling events. The 2025 edition saw a 37% increase compared to 2022, with tourist participation reaching 10,000 attendees. Squali Gravel: An adventure in nature
Saturday 16th May 2026 will see the Squali Gravel take place. This competition will follow the picturesque route of the Conca Valley, allowing participants to immerse themselves in nature as they cycle along dirt tracks. Two routes will be available:
Toro Tour (80 km, 1,650 m elevation gain): a challenging adventure through valleys, medieval fortresses and forests.
Verdesca Tour (45 km, 700 m elevation gain): a more accessible route, ideal for those seeking a moderate challenge whilst still immersed in the heart of nature.
